Like the Amazon Kindle, the Vox eReader is both an ebook reader and a tablet with a custom user interface built on Android. Social networking integration has been a focus with the Kobo ereaders and the Kobo Vox is inspired by Vox Populi, the voice of the people, with extensive social interaction. You will find Kobo integrates Facebook Ticker and Timeline to enable reading discovery and Pulse to find book recommendations.
Specifications and features of the Kobo Vox eReader include:
- 7 inch anti-glare color display at 1280x800 resolution
- Weight of 14.2 ounces
- 8GB internal memory for over 5,000 books with microSD storage option
- Battery of up to 7 hours
- Android 2.3 operating system with support for over 15,000 free apps
- Kobo and Facebook widgets on the home screen
- Web browser
- Full featured email client
- Unlimited music from RDIO
